The product parameters are precisely calibrated to meet the complex working conditions of agricultural spraying, with excellent batch-to-batch stability. The specific indicators are as follows:
| Parameter Item | Specific Indicator | Significance of Indicator |
|---|---|---|
| Viscosity (25℃) | 80-100 cps (mPa.s) | Ensures good stability and adhesion after mixing with various pesticide solutions, suitable for mixing with high-viscosity formulations (such as concentrated emulsions), and enhances the retention effect of the pesticide solution on crop surfaces. |
| Surface Tension (0.1% Concentration) | < 21 mN/m | Far below the critical wetting value of plant leaves, rapidly reduces the contact angle between the pesticide solution and the leaf surface, achieving efficient spreading, wetting and penetration, and increasing the target coverage area and absorption efficiency. |
| Cloud Point | < 10℃ (aqueous solution environment) | Suitable for low-temperature to normal-temperature operation scenarios, maintaining stable performance within the normal agricultural production temperature range and not affected by temperature fluctuations. |
| pH Applicable Range | 6-8 | Matches the pH range of most pesticides and foliar fertilizers, avoiding performance degradation caused by acidic or alkaline environments and ensuring the stability of the efficacy after mixing. |
| Core Performance Rating | Wetting ★★★★, Spreading ★★★★, Penetrating ★★★★, Retention ★★★★ | Excellent balanced performance in four dimensions, and the strong retention feature extends the persistence of the pesticide solution, reduces the frequency of repeated application, and improves the efficiency of application operations. |
As a super spreading-penetrating and retention-type additive, at a concentration of 0.1%, it can reduce the surface tension of the pesticide solution to below 21 mN/m, quickly wetting the leaf surfaces of crops with thick waxy layers (such as citrus and grapes), rough branches and the bodies of pests. Its spreading area is several times that of ordinary additives. At the same time, it promotes the rapid absorption of the pesticide solution through leaf stomata, with the pesticide absorption rate reaching more than 85% within 10 minutes, significantly improving the efficacy by 30-60%; the strong retention feature extends the persistence of the pesticide solution by 20-30%, and enhances rainfastness to avoid efficacy loss caused by rainfall. It is especially suitable for rainy areas and scenarios with long-term control requirements.
It is compatible with various agricultural chemicals such as insecticides, fungicides, herbicides, foliar fertilizers, plant growth regulators, and biological pesticides, with no risk of mixing conflicts. It is suitable for multiple application equipment such as high-pressure sprayers, UAV spraying, and electrostatic spraying, and performs well in various planting scenarios such as fruit trees, field crops, and cash crops. It can especially effectively solve the control problems of hidden pests (such as scale insects and longhorn beetles) and branch diseases (such as canker), reducing spraying blind spots and repeated application costs.
The product has low toxicity, high safety for higher animals, and is easily degradable in the natural environment without residual pollution risks, meeting international agricultural environmental protection and safety standards. Through synergistic and persistence-extending effects, it can reduce pesticide usage and application frequency by 30-60%, which not only reduces agricultural production costs but also reduces the impact of pesticides on the ecological environment, helping to achieve green and sustainable agricultural development.
When used as one of the components of pesticide formulations, the recommended addition amount is 0.1%-5%, specifically adjusted according to the formulation type (such as concentrated emulsion, suspension concentrate) and persistence requirements. During production, the system pH needs to be stabilized at 6.5-7.5 through a retarder to ensure that the product continues to exert stable performance and retention effect within the shelf life of the formulation.
